Matthew 12:11
English Standard Version
11 He said to them, “Which one of you who has a sheep, (A)if it falls into a pit on the Sabbath, will not take hold of it and lift it out?

Deuteronomy 22:4
English Standard Version
4 (A)You shall not see your brother's donkey or his ox fallen down by the way and ignore them. You shall help him to lift them up again.

Luke 14:5
English Standard Version
5 And he said to them, (A)“Which of you, having a son[a] or an ox that has fallen into a well on a Sabbath day, will not immediately pull him out?”

Luke 13:15-17
English Standard Version
15 Then the Lord answered him, “You hypocrites! (A)Does not each of you on the Sabbath untie his ox or his donkey from the manger and lead it away to water it? 16 And ought not this woman, (B)a daughter of Abraham whom (C)Satan bound for eighteen years, be loosed from this bond on the Sabbath day?” 17 As he said these things, (D)all his adversaries were put to shame, and (E)all the people rejoiced at all the glorious things that were done by him.

Exodus 23:4-5
English Standard Version
4 (A)“If you meet your enemy's ox or his donkey going astray, you shall bring it back to him. 5 If you see the donkey of one who hates you lying down under its burden, you shall refrain from leaving him with it; you shall rescue it with him.
